AI-powered breath test detects covid among Emiratis within seconds
Even as a robust vaccination drive is underway in the Emirates, testing and tracing of covid positive patients remains a crucial tool for containing infections. The year of the pandemic saw deployment of data collection, online apps and devices to detect symptoms of covid in public spaces of the UAE, for successfully keeping an outbreak at bay. With negative test results becoming a key document for international travel, quicker and convenient procedures are being developed to scale up covid detection. Continuing its legacy of adopting latest innovations in tech, Dubai has started experimenting with a breath test, which can spot covid in less than a minute. The device developed by University of Singapore-backed firm Breathonix, uses machine learning to identify volatile organic compound created by biochemical reactions, to give results in seconds.
